IN A bid to stimulate small business growth and formalise the city’s enterprise sector, the Harare City Council (HCC) has slashed shop licence fees by 50 percent in its proposed US$690,8 million 2026 budget. JUSTICE ministry permanent secretary Vimbai Nyemba’s recent visit to Chikurubi Maximum Security Prison on Wednesday to interact with former death row inmates deserves recognition. Apart from giving these inmates renewed hope for rebuilding their lives following their resentencing, Nyemba’s gesture demonstrates the government’s commitment to embedding the ban on the death penalty.
